Fox's 'Gotham' is releasing its midseason premiere this week. Actor Robin Lord Taylor speaks with Cheddar about why he thinks we're living in the golden age of media and explains how the success of Netflix has pushed the quality of broadcast TV series forward.
"The best thing about our show is-- we are so fortunate for the trajectory of our show," says Taylor. "With age it just gets better and better."
Last week Netflix announce it is spending $8 billion to produce 700 original shows and movies in 2018. Taylor says he feels it is the golden age of media.
